General Information

Communications Department

Looking for an opportunity to build your portfolio, learn more about the world of marketing/communications, and spend your work-study hours in a creative environment? The MAC Communications Department is looking for student creatives who are eager to be artistic and seek an outlet and a chance to learn more about video editing, photography, graphic design, and more. Applicants will be required to interview with the Communications Department before accepting a position. Positions are limited and go very quickly every semester so apply early. Email swagner@mtaloy.edu with your name and interested position to learn more or apply. Marketing Assistants will clip newspaper articles for stories and references for Mount Aloysius College . Also responsible for bulletin board postings, clipping all Mount Aloysius ads and pasting them into binder, clipping competitors ads and pasting them into binder. In addition, the assistant will help write press releases, attend events and take photos, run errands on campus, faxing, copying, typing of documents and work events as needed such as Madrigal, Golf Tournament, Alumni Weekend.
